Developed in response to industry research and consultation, the Supervisor TAE10 Skill Set Program has been designed specifically to improve the training skills of supervisors of indentured trainees or apprentices in any industry. This training will provide organisations with critical core competencies to ensure that their technical and professional people are performing consistently, confidently and competently to the set benchmarks.
This programme will benefit
Enterprise supervisors and managers, team leaders and safety officers accountable for providing work skills training, mentoring and assess nationally endorsed units or qualifications. In particular these competencies are identified as essential for those engaged in supervising apprentices and trainees. This program is also very relevant to an enterprise that works together with a Registered Training Organisation (RTO) in an auspice arrangement.
Eligible applicants for funding
Only supervisors, managers or team leaders of one or more apprentices or trainees registered in the Department's Training Registration System (TRS) may undertake the training. 3CM is able to deliver this programme in the Perth or regional centres around WA.

Learning outcomes
- Develop skills, knowledge and attitude to mentor staff in the workplace
- Contribute to workplace assessment safely within an assessment plan and learning pathway
- Deliver one-to-one or small group training sessions, using a variety of methods to support learning and provide opportunities for practice.
Optional learning outcomes
The additional unit BSBCMM401A - Make a presentation may be added to the three core units if undertaken by a workplace supervisor who is required to make presentations to groups that exceed five (5) apprentices or trainees.
Pathway
The TAE units provide credit towards TAE40110 Certificate IV in Training and Assessment. These units from TAE10 Training and Education Training Package, when used with relevant vocational competencies, meet industry requirements for mentoring apprentices and trainees.
Learning Strategy
Students will take part in a highly interactive project forum, with group discussion and collaborative research for maximum impact and learning. The DiSC behavioural profiling is used in relation to strengths and challenges. This is followed up with 4 half day project forums for students to work on their projects and receive feedback from an Assessor. Projects are linked to the organisation’s strategic themes and core values, making them applied to real situations, rather than theory and textbook.
